As the name suggests, room air coolers are accustomed to cool a room. They work by drawing in hot air from the room and passing it over a wet evaporative pad. This process of evaporation cools the air, that will be then blown back into the room. Room air coolers are a great way to help keep cool in the summertime months, and can be much more cost-effective than air conditioners.
There are a few things to remember when utilizing a room air cooler. First, make sure you keep carefully the cooler clean and free of debris. The evaporative pads will have to be replaced periodically, and the cooler should be drained and refilled with fresh water as needed. Additionally, make sure you keep carefully the cooler far from any sources of heat, such as for example stoves or heaters.

As the summertime heat intensifies, people are looking for methods to beat the heat. Room air coolers are a favorite choice for many because they are a cost-effective method to cool off a room. But how can they work?
Room air coolers work by passing air over a wetted surface. The air is cooled because it evaporates the water and this cooler air is then circulated into the room.
There are a few things to consider whenever choosing a room air cooler. The size of the machine is essential since it must manage to circulate the air in the room. The capability of the machine can be important since it must manage to hold enough water to evaporate and cool the air.
